Background
As is known to all, the artificial lawn is easy to adhere more fluff and dust in the production process, and the dust removal and fluff clearing device is equipment for removing the fluff and dust adhered to the artificial lawn; the existing artificial lawn fluff dust removing equipment mostly adopts the dust suction fan, the adsorption of the dust suction fan is used for removing the adhered fluff and dust at the position of the artificial lawn, and the situation that the fluff and dust at the position of the artificial lawn are completely removed by simply adopting the adsorption effect of the high-power dust suction fan is found in use, the high-power dust suction fan has high noise, part of fluff is adhered at the position of the artificial lawn, and the effects of dust removal and fluff removal are further improved.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, the utility model discloses a dust removal and fluff removal device, including frame 1, two sets of driving cylinders 2, two sets of lift seat 3, suction hood 4, roller brush 5, mounting bracket 6 and the drive assembly that provides power for roller brush 5 rotates, two sets of driving cylinders 2 are symmetrically installed on frame 1, lift seat 3 can be up-and-down slidably installed on frame 1, lift seat 3 is fixedly installed in the output of driving cylinder 2, suction hood 4 is fixedly installed between two sets of lift seats 3, roller brush 5 is rotatable to be installed on suction hood 4, mounting bracket 6 is fixedly installed on frame 1, the drive assembly includes driving gear 7, driven gear 8 and the actuating mechanism 9 that provides power for driving gear 7 rotates, driving gear 7 is rotatable to be installed on mounting bracket 6, driven gear 8 is fixed to be installed in roller brush 5 one end; furthermore, a driving motor and a driving belt are preferably selected as the driving mechanism 9, the driving motor is fixedly arranged on the mounting frame 6, and the output end of the driving motor is in transmission connection with the driving gear 7 through the driving belt; the driving mechanism 9 can also adopt a driving motor independently, the driving motor is fixedly arranged on the mounting frame 6, and the output end of the driving motor is fixedly connected with the driving gear 7; the driving motor rotates, and the driving gear 7 rotates after transmission of the driving belt.
Specifically, the roller brush dust collector further comprises two groups of bearing seats 10, mounting grooves are formed in two sides of the dust collection cover 4, guide rods 11 are fixedly mounted in the mounting grooves, the bearing seats 10 are arranged at the positions of the guide rods 11 in a vertically sliding mode, springs 12 are sleeved on the guide rods 11, one ends of the springs 12 are connected with the inner wall of the mounting grooves, the other ends of the springs 12 are connected with the bearing seats 10, and the roller brush 5 is rotatably mounted between the two groups of bearing seats 10; the bearing seat 10 can be installed at the guide rod 11 in a vertically sliding manner, under the action of the spring 12, the roller brush 5 can be elastically contacted with the artificial lawn, the roller brush 5 is prevented from being excessively in close contact with the artificial lawn to influence the normal rotation of the roller brush 5, and the effect of removing fluff and dust at the artificial lawn by the roller brush 5 is ensured.
Specifically, two groups of supporting rollers 13 are rotatably mounted at the top end of the dust hood 4, the two groups of supporting rollers 13 are respectively positioned at two sides of the roller brush 5, two groups of compression rollers 14 are rotatably mounted at the bottom of the mounting frame 6, and the two groups of compression rollers 14 are respectively positioned right above the two groups of roller brushes 5; the supporting rollers 13 can support the passing artificial turf, the artificial turf is pressed on the supporting rollers 13 by the pressing rollers 14, and the artificial turf is ensured to be in a relaxation state in the process of dedusting and brushing the artificial turf by the roller brush 5, so that dust and brushes on the artificial turf are better removed.
Specifically, two groups of driving gears 7 and two groups of driven gears 8 are respectively arranged, the two groups of driven gears 8 are respectively and fixedly arranged at the end parts of the two ends of the roller brush 5, the two groups of driving gears 7 are respectively and rotatably arranged at the bottom of the mounting frame 6, and the driving gears 7 are positioned above the driven gears 8; through two sets of settings of driving gear 7 and driven gear 8, realize the atress balance at 5 both ends of roller brush, make roller brush 5 and artificial turf keep balanced contact, avoid roller brush 5 to appear the situation of one end slope because of the atress inequality and take place, make roller brush 5 and artificial turf contact even to guarantee that roller brush 5 is to the effect of cleaing away of adnexed dust and fine hair in artificial turf department.
Specifically, the dust hood further comprises a suction fan 15 and a corrugated expansion pipe 16, wherein the suction fan 15 is fixedly arranged at the bottom of the dust hood 4, the input end of the suction fan 15 is communicated with the output end of the dust hood 4, and the output end of the suction fan 15 is communicated with the input end of the corrugated expansion pipe 16; the output end of the corrugated expansion pipe 16 is communicated with external dust removal equipment, negative pressure is sucked through the suction fan 15, dust in the dust hood 4 is sucked and conveyed into the external dust removal equipment, and the dust and fluff are prevented from being excessively gathered in the dust hood 4.
Specifically, an electrostatic dust catching net 17 is arranged in the dust hood 4; the electrostatic dust catching net 17 can perform electrostatic absorption and catching on dust and fluff in the dust hood 4, and under the negative pressure absorption effect of the suction fan 15, the dust and the fluff are prevented from escaping from the upper part of the dust hood 4, and the dust and the fluff are prevented from being secondarily adhered to the artificial lawn.
When the artificial lawn cleaning device is used, the driving cylinder 2 is in an extension state, the artificial lawn is bypassed from the top of the roller brush 5, the output end of the driving cylinder 2 is shortened, the lifting seat 3 drives the dust hood 4 to move upwards, the roller brush 5 is in close contact with the artificial lawn, the artificial lawn is pressed on the supporting roller 13 by the pressing roller 14 and is in a relaxation state, the driving gear 7 is meshed with the driven gear 8, the driving gear 7 is driven by the driving mechanism 9 to rotate, the roller brush 5 rotates after the driving gear 8 is driven, dust and fluff adhered to the artificial lawn are cleaned by the roller brush 5, the dust and the fluff fall into the dust hood 4, the fluff and the dust at the artificial lawn are cleaned in a brushing mode by the roller brush 5, and the brushed dust or the fluff are sucked and transported to an external dust removal device by the suction fan 15.
